About this spot

The Yoshidagawa Riverside Promenade (吉田川親水遊歩道) is a walking path and river-play spot laid out along the Yoshida River (吉田川) as it flows through the castle town of Gujo Hachiman. Diving from Shinbashi Bridge (新橋) is known as a local tradition, but it carries danger, so small children are safest playing in the shallows along the promenade. The clear water and gentle current are perfect for water play, and you can even see Gujo Hachiman Castle (郡上八幡城) from the riverbank. It is the climax of a day in which families can fully enjoy the pure stream unique to the water town of Gujo Hachiman.

Tips

Even in the shallows the current speed varies by spot, so never take your eyes off small children. Non-slip river shoes are reassuring. Some areas fall into shade in the evening, so bring something to put on so nobody gets chilled.

Best time to visit

After 1 p.m., when the sun has warmed the water, is the best time for river play.
